Padmaja Venugopal: Early Life and Political Journey

  • Padmaja Venugopal, a prominent figure in Indian politics, was born in 1961 in Kerala.
  • Hailing from a family deeply entrenched in political affairs, she is the daughter of the esteemed Indian National Congress (INC) leader and former chief minister of Kerala, K. Karunakaran.
  • Additionally, she is the sister of K. Muraleedharan, the current Member of Parliament representing Vatakara constituency.

Political Journey of Padmaja: Stepping into the Realm of Indian Politics

Padmaja embarked on her political journey, following the illustrious path paved by her father, during the early 2000s.

Her foray into electoral politics marked a significant stride towards contributing to the socio-political landscape of India.

Padmaja’s Entry into Indian General Elections of 2004

In the watershed 2004 Indian general elections, Padmaja made her debut by contesting from the then Mukundapuram constituency for a seat in the Lok Sabha.

Despite her fervent efforts, victory eluded her as Lonappan Nambadan of CPI(M) emerged triumphant.

Quest for Representation: Kerala Legislative Assembly Elections

Undeterred by setbacks, Padmaja continued to pursue her political aspirations, vying for representation in the Kerala Legislative Assembly.

Twice, in the 2016 and 2021 elections, she threw her hat into the ring as a candidate of the Indian National Congress (INC) from the Thrissur constituency. However, victory remained elusive.

Congress Leader Padmaja Venugopal Joins BJP, Citing Lack of Strong Leadership

In a significant political move ahead of the Lok Sabha elections, Padmaja Venugopal, a prominent Congress leader and daughter of the late K Karunakaran, former Chief Minister of Kerala, announced her decision to join the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) in New Delhi.

Venugopal expressed her discontent with the grand old party, citing its prolonged lack of robust leadership.

Challenges Within the Congress

Addressing a press conference alongside BJP leaders at the party’s headquarters, Venugopal revealed her persistent efforts to communicate her grievances to the Congress leadership, which went unanswered.

“I repeatedly raised my concerns with the Congress high command, but received no acknowledgment. Despite multiple attempts to secure an audience with the party leadership, my requests were ignored,” Venugopal lamented.

Discontent Leading to Departure

Expressing her dissatisfaction with the Congress, particularly since the last Kerala assembly elections, Venugopal emphasized her desire for a conducive working environment. She drew parallels with her father’s disillusionment with the party.

Quest for Strong Leadership

Venugopal underscored the necessity for robust leadership within political parties and commended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s authoritative leadership within the BJP.

“In contrast to the Congress, where leadership is lacking, Prime Minister Modi exemplifies strong leadership. While I hold Sonia ji in high regard, accessibility to her has been limited,” Venugopal remarked.

Padmaja Venugopal Joins BJP, Shifting Kerala’s Political Landscape

Padmaja Venugopal, a notable figure in Kerala’s political sphere and the daughter of the late Chief Minister K. Karunakaran, has made a significant move by joining the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P).

Embracing Change: Padmaja Venugopal’s Transition to BJP

  • In a formal ceremony held at the BJP headquarters in New Delhi, the BJP Kerala-in-charge, Prakash Javadekar, extended a warm welcome to Padmaja Venugopal as she officially joined the party ranks.
  • Expressing her sentiments on this transition, Ms. Venugopal stated that while it was a difficult decision to leave the party she grew up with, she felt compelled to make this move due to perceived disconnection within the Congress leadership.
  • She emphasized her admiration for Sonia Gandhi but highlighted a growing sense of distance and inaccessibility.
  • Reflecting on her father’s experiences, she noted a similar sentiment of being sidelined within the Congress, ultimately influencing her decision to align with the BJP.
  • She underscored the absence of a singular unifying leader within the Congress akin to Prime Minister Narendra Modi, which played a pivotal role in her realignment.

Impact on Kerala Politics: The BJP’s Growing Influence

The defection of Padmaja Venugopal marks yet another significant shift in Kerala’s political landscape, following a series of high-profile exits from the Congress to the BJP over the past year.

Discontent within the Congress: A Growing Trend

The departure of key figures such as Padmaja Venugopal and Anil K. Antony has sparked concerns within the Kerala Pradesh Congress Committee (KPCC) regarding the party’s cohesion and ability to navigate crucial national elections.

Anticipated Electoral Strategies: BJP’s Tactical Moves

With the upcoming elections looming, there is speculation regarding the BJP’s strategic deployment of newly acquired assets such as Padmaja Venugopal, potentially leveraging her candidacy in key constituencies like Chalakudy to challenge established Congress incumbents like Benny Behanan.
